- Abstract
- A simple BODIPY derivative is demonstrated to fluorescently sense Hg2+ in a ratiometric manner. The probe, an 8-methylthio-BODIPY, undergoes Hg2+-promoted hydrolysis to produce the corresponding 8-hydroxy-BODIPY, which conversion is accompanied with a large emission wavelength change. The probe can selectively detect Hg2+ over various other metal cations, with a detection limit of 1 ppb. (C) 2012 Elsevier Ltd. All rights reserved.
